First and foremost, set a budget. Decide how much money you are going to
spend on your
kitchen renovation project. To have a budget already set for a
specific project will help you decide more easily how far you will go in
terms of choosing the materials and design for your kitchen renovation.
If possible, price out every item you want to include in your new
kitchen, like new appliances, fixtures and accessories. Do not leave
anything off your list; as much as possible include even the smallest
detail like paints and brushes. There are wide ranges of materials
available so you can choose from whichever price range you can afford.
Once everything is priced, add 20% onto the cost of the job because you
never know when things will go wrong and you suddenly find yourself out
of budget.

Today there are a lot of kitchen designs to choose from and in varied
themes like old world style, European and American country style,
Victorian Kitchens, American Traditional, Shaker style and the list goes
on. Choose a design which suits your personality, lifestyle and the
style of your house itself. There are at least four basic kitchen
layouts than you can choose from and incorporate in your own kitchen.
1. Single-wall Layout: This layout is usually done with small
spaces where all the appliances and cabinetry are placed against one
wall, where there's no other place to put it. A full height unit like a
refrigerator must be placed at one end while a cooktop should be placed
near the sink and never at the end of the run. Otherwise it will create
an unsafe environment and at the same time add unnecessary steps to the
cooking process.
2. Corridor Layout: A corridor or galley layout is made of two
opposing counters which should be at least 42" apart. This is also a
good design layout for small spaces but has the added advantage over the
single-wall layout since, the work-triangle principle can be applied
here, although this layout sometimes suffers from traffic passing
through.
3. L-shaped Layout: An L-shaped layout is usually a more
desirable layout for a kitchen with limited space, compared with both
the single layout and the corridor layout. The work triangle can be
designed in such a way that there will be fewer steps for the cook thus
making the cooking experience less arduous. It's also usually free from
traffic snarls compared with the corridor layout. Make sure however,
that the counters are not interrupted by the passage door, refrigerator
or full length cabinets.
4. U-shaped Layout: The U-shaped layout is by far the most
versatile and efficient kitchen layout. If your space and budget can
accommodate this type go for it. This type of layout makes the most of
the working triangle principle. All the appliances, storage systems and
work areas face each other and are directed towards a central point -
the kitchen operator.
After deciding on which layout you would like for your kitchen, then
it's time to get down to details. Take into consideration the comfort of
the cook. There should be a minimum distance between repetitive chores
to save the cook from fatigue therefore adding comfort and pleasure to
the entire cooking experience. Lots of pantry storage and pull out
drawers for everyday use dishes would be an indispensable part of the
kitchen cabinetry. For drawers, the use of full extension drawer slides
indicates good quality drawers. This will allow easy access to those
hard to reach objects and provides strong and sturdy support for fully
loaded and heavy drawers. Consider also the countertop material.
Countertop dictates much of the appearance and overall atmosphere of the
entire kitchen especially if your kitchen design includes a large
uninterrupted counter space. You can choose from a variety of materials
like Laminate, Solid surface material sold under such names as Corian,
Surrell, Gibraltar etc.., Ceramic tile, Granite and Marble, Stainless
steel, Soapstone, Lavastone, Butcher's Block counters.
A seating area for those who are not actively participating in the
cooking process but are there to accompany the cook for lively
conversation is an added bonus to any kitchen design. If space is
available, adding an island not only creates a good focal point but it
also gives an added counter space, a good place for a quick meal or just
a place where kids can hang out while mom prepares their favorite meal.
The key to a successful kitchen design is the complete understanding of
the true needs of the intended user. Once this is achieved, everything
else in the design will just follow.
